A course in amplitudes [PDF]

open access: yesPhysics Reports, 2017
This a pedagogical introduction to scattering amplitudes in gauge theories. It proceeds from Dirac equation and Weyl fermions to the two pivot points of current developments: the recursion relations of Britto, Cachazo, Feng and Witten, and the unitarity cut method pioneered by Bern, Dixon, Dunbar and Kosower.

Twistors and amplitudes [PDF]

open access: yesPhilosophical Transactions of the Royal Society A: Mathematical, Physical and Engineering Sciences, 2015
A brief review is given of why twistor geometry has taken a central place in the theory of scattering amplitudes for fundamental particles. The emphasis is on the twistor diagram formalism as originally proposed by Penrose, the development of which has now led to the definition by Arkani-Hamedet al.of the ‘amplituhedron’.

The Bs oscillation amplitude analysis [PDF]

open access: yes, 1999
The properties of the amplitude method for $\Bs$ oscillation analyses are studied in detail. The world combination of measured amplitudes is converted into a likelihood profile as a function of oscillation frequency.
